Describe the bug

inputDataconfig is incorrectly marked as a required field on SageMakerCreateTrainingJobProps. Forcing this value to undefined throws a Cannot read properties of undefined error.

An empty list is not accepted by SageMaker:

"1 validation errors detected: Value '[]' at 'inputDataConfig' failed to satisfy constraint: Member must have length greater than or equal to 1 (Service: AmazonSageMaker; Status Code: 400; Error Code: ValidationException; Request ID: 20b3ebdb-d89d-4dbe-882b-377d50058e93; Proxy: null)"

Relevant SageMakerCreateTrainingJob docs: https://docs.aws.amazon.com/sagemaker/latest/APIReference/API_CreateTrainingJob.html#sagemaker-CreateTrainingJob-request-InputDataConfig

Expected Behavior

A valid SageMakerCreateTrainingJob step function task can be created when inputDataConfig is undefined.

Current Behavior

SageMakerCreateTrainingJob throws an error when inputDataConfig is undefined.

Argument of type '{ trainingJobName: string; algorithmSpecification: { trainingImage: aws_stepfunctions_tasks.DockerImage; trainingInputMode: aws_stepfunctions_tasks.InputMode.FILE; }; outputDataConfig: { ...; }; resourceConfig: { ...; }; stoppingCondition: { ...; }; hyperparameters: {}; }' is not assignable to parameter of type 'SageMakerCreateTrainingJobProps'.
  Property 'inputDataConfig' is missing in type '{ trainingJobName: string; algorithmSpecification: { trainingImage: aws_stepfunctions_tasks.DockerImage; trainingInputMode: aws_stepfunctions_tasks.InputMode.FILE; }; outputDataConfig: { ...; }; resourceConfig: { ...; }; stoppingCondition: { ...; }; hyperparameters: {}; }' but required in type 'SageMakerCreateTrainingJobProps'.ts(2345)

Reproduction Steps

import { Duration, Size } from 'aws-cdk-lib';
import { InstanceType } from 'aws-cdk-lib/aws-ec2';
import { JsonPath } from 'aws-cdk-lib/aws-stepfunctions';
import { DockerImage, InputMode, S3Location, SageMakerCreateTrainingJob } from 'aws-cdk-lib/aws-stepfunctions-tasks';
import { Construct } from 'constructs';

class Workflow extends Construct {
  constructor(scope: Construct, id: string) {
    super(scope, id);

    const sageMakerInvocation = new SageMakerCreateTrainingJob(this, 'Start SageMaker', {
      trainingJobName: JsonPath.stringAt('$.JobName'),
      algorithmSpecification: {
        trainingImage: DockerImage.fromJsonExpression('$.DockerImagePath'),
        trainingInputMode: InputMode.FILE,
      },
      // inputDataConfig: [],
      outputDataConfig: {
        s3OutputLocation: S3Location.fromJsonExpression('$.S3OutputPath'),
      },
      resourceConfig: {
        instanceCount: 1,
        instanceType: new InstanceType(JsonPath.stringAt('$.InstanceType')),
        volumeSize: Size.gibibytes(JsonPath.numberAt('$.InstanceVolumeSize')),
      },
      stoppingCondition: {
        maxRuntime: Duration.seconds(JsonPath.numberAt('$.MaximumJobDuration')),
      },
    });
  }
}

I can confirm that SageMaker will accept and run jobs without InputDataConfig set.

The latest JavaScript SDK does not mark InputDataConfig as required.

The latest AWS CLI reference also does not mark InputdataConfig as required.

### Reason for this change

`inputDataConfig` is not a required property in the API:
https://docs.aws.amazon.com/sagemaker/latest/APIReference/API_CreateTrainingJob.html#sagemaker-CreateTrainingJob-request-InputDataConfig

However in `SageMakerCreateTrainingJob`, it's marked as required. We should make it align with the API.

### Description of changes

Make the property optional.

### Description of how you validated changes

unit test and integration test
